...from New York.
Listening - To understand native speakers without subtitles, without getting lost.
Vocabulary - Several thousand idioms, slang, phrasal verbs, grammar, and cultural explanations.
Speaking - To identify and imitate native speech patterns - how we cut, connect, and eat our...